Grand Island had won four straight games and Victor Fisher Jr. did his part to make it five on Saturday. The Grand Island Islanders came within a single point of losing the streak, but they secured a 44-43 W against the Buena Vista Bison which was due in part to Fisher Jr., who dropped a double-double with 18 points and 13 rebounds. The dominant performance also gave him a new career-high in blocks (five).
Riley Holling was another key player, putting up 11 points. He is also on a roll when it comes to field goal percentage, as he's posted one of at least 60% in the last three games he's played.
Grand Island's win was their first in the district, bumping their district record up to 1-2 and their overall record up to 13-11. As for Buena Vista, they have been struggling recently as they've lost three of their last four contests. That's put a noticeable dent in their 15-11 record this season.
Grand Island will head out to face off against Papillion-LaVista South at 7:00 p.m. on Tuesday. One thing working in Papillion-LaVista South's favor is that they have posted at least 55 points in their last 13 matches. Buena Vista does not have any more games scheduled as of now.
